BIOS is non-volatile firmware used to perform hardware initialization during the booting process And the first American Megatrends (AMI) BIOS was released on .. 1st edition, a freely available book in PDF format; More Power To Firmware, free bonus chapter to the Mac OS X Internals: A Systems Approach book. Advanced x BIOS and System Management Mode Internals Boot Process . Code Appendix: –AMI Bios Code Definition –Phoenix Bios Code Definition. Disconnected all peripherals and looked to disconnect all internals and re add them

Author: Tojashura Tojasar
Country: Cambodia
Language: English (Spanish)
Genre: Video
Published (Last): 6 May 2007
Pages: 158
PDF File Size: 3.65 Mb
ePub File Size: 11.66 Mb
ISBN: 878-3-11534-115-4
Downloads: 44123
Price: Free* [*Free Regsitration Required]
Uploader: Gazuru

The BIOS was hard-coded to boot from the first floppy drive, or, if that failed, the first hard disk. Most BIOS implementations are specifically designed to work with a particular computer or motherboard model, by interfacing with various devices that make up the complementary system chipset. Trusted computing and digital rights management clearinghouse. Bob Fraley, Edited by: Also, when errors occur at boot time, a modern BIOS usually displays user-friendly error messages, often presented as pop-up boxes in a TUI style, and offers to enter the BIOS setup utility or to ignore the error and proceed if possible.

SP points to a valid stack that is presumably large enough to support hardware interrupts, but otherwise SS and SP are undefined. This manual describes the operation of the amibios rom utilities.

More recent operating systems do not use the BIOS after loading, instead accessing the hardware components directly. For comparable software on other computer systems, see booting. The environment for the boot program is very simple: Other alternatives to the functionality of the “Legacy BIOS” in the x86 world include coreboot and libreboot.

In most modern BIOSes, the boot priority order of all potentially bootable devices can be freely configured by the user through the BIOS configuration utility.

Amibios internals and pdf

Code in these extensions runs before the BIOS boots the system from mass storage. Cracks for non-genuine Windows distributions usually edit the SLIC or emulate it in order to bypass Windows activation. There is also extra protection from accidental BIOS rewrites in the form of boot blocks which are protected from accidental overwrite or dual and quad BIOS equipped systems which may, in the event of a crash, use a backup BIOS.


The boot program must set up its own stack or at least MS-DOS 6 acts like it mustbecause the size of the stack set up by BIOS is unknown and its location is likewise variable; although the boot program can investigate the default stack by examining SS: Please help improve this section by adding citations to reliable sources.

Following the boot priority sequence in effect, BIOS checks each device in order to see if it is bootable.

Now that the BIOS is separated out, anybody could write a BIOS for their machine, if it was based, and run this, so he started selling that separately under the company Digital Research that he formed and did quite well. The motherboard manufacturer then customizes this BIOS to suit its own hardware. Imsai interals, Incorporated, for whom Glenn consulted, had shipped a large number of disk subsystems with a promise that an operating system would follow.

SP, it is easier and shorter to intefnals unconditionally set up a new stack. Miscellaneous platform enabling 1. It may use BIOS services including those provided by previously initialized option ROMs to provide a user configuration interface, to display diagnostic information, or to do anything else that it requires.

Despite these requirements, Ortega underlined the profound implications of his and Sacco’s discovery: Tsr programming tsr or terminate and stay resident programming is one of the interesting topics in dos programming.

Volume 7, Issue 4. Flat protected mode 3. If the system has just been powered up or the reset button was pressed “cold boot”the full power-on self-test POST is run.

BIOS – Wikipedia

CIH was also called the “Chernobyl Virus”, because its payload date wasthe 13th anniversary of the Chernobyl accident. Graphics programming with gdi directx pdf download. We think you internale liked this presentation.

If the download was apparently successful, the BIOS would verify a checksum on it and then run it. If the sector cannot be read due to a missing or unformatted disk, or due to a hardware failurethe BIOS considers the device unbootable and proceeds to check the next device. A modern Wintel -compatible computer provides a setup routine essentially unchanged in nature from the ROM-resident BIOS setup utilities of the late s; the user can configure hardware options using the keyboard and video display.


Retrieved 2 February The first flash chips were attached to the ISA bus. For a disk drive or a device that logically emulates a disk drive, such as a USB flash drive or perhaps a tape drive, to perform this check the BIOS attempts to load the first sector boot sector from the disk into RAM at memory address 0x EEPROM chips are advantageous because they can be easily updated by the user; it is customary for hardware manufacturers to issue BIOS updates to upgrade their products, improve compatibility and remove bugs.

Compactflash card type i, compactflash card type ii, memory stick, memory stick duo, memory stick pro, memory stick pro duo, microdrive, multimediacard. An extension ROM could in principle contain an entire operating system or an application program, or it could implement an entirely different boot process such as booting from a network. Share buttons are a little bit lower.

Nothing about BIOS predicates these data structures or impedes their replacement or improvement. A BIOS might be reflashed in order to upgrade to a newer version to fix bugs or provide improved performance or to support newer hardware, or a reflashing operation might be needed to fix a internald BIOS.

The Win32 Boot Process. Since the AT-compatible BIOS ran in Intel real modeoperating systems that ran in protected mode on and later processors required hardware device drivers compatible with protected mode operation to replace BIOS services.

This section does not cite any sources.